Thermodynamics Multiple Choice Questions on “Pure Substance”.
1. Which of the following represents the specific volume during phase transition.
a) Vf-Vg
b) Vg-Vf
c) Vf+Vg
d) none of the mentioned
Answer: b
Clarification: Here Vg is the specific volume of the saturated vapour and Vf is the specific volume of the saturated liquid.
2. At critical point, value of Vg-Vf is
a) two
b) one
c) zero
d) infinity
Answer: c
Clarification: As pressure increases, there is a decrease in Vg-Vf and at critical point its value becomes zero.
3. Above the critical point, the isotherms are continuous curves.
a) true
b) false
Answer: a
Clarification: These continuous curves approach equilateral hyperbolas at large volumes and low pressures.

9. An 80 litre vessel contains 4 kg of R-134a at a pressure of 160 kPa. Determine the quality.
a) 0.127
b) 0.137
c) 0.147
d) 0.157
Answer: d
Clarification: v = V/m = 0.080 m3/4 kg = 0.02 m3/kg
@ 160kPa, vf = 0.0007437 m3/kg; vg = 0.12348 m3/kg.
vf < v < vg
x = (v –vf)/ vfg = 0.157.
10. An 80 litre vessel contains 4 kg of R-134a at a pressure of 160 kPa. Determine the volume occupied by the vapour phase.
a) 0.0775 m3
b) 0.0575 m3
c) 0.0975 m3
d) 0.0375 m3
Answer: a
Clarification: v = V/m = 0.080 m3/4 kg = 0.02 m3/kg
@ 160kPa, vf = 0.0007437 m3/kg; vg = 0.12348 m3/kg
vf < v < vg
x = (v –vf)/ vfg = 0.157
mg = x*m(total) = 0.628kg
Vg = mg*vg = 0.0775 m3 or 77.5 litre.
